Checklist: Quillbase ORM refactor, milestone 3. Plugin authors: legacy ActiveRow adapters are deprecated; migrate to the new mapper interface before the freeze. Verify your plugin compiles against the shim, passes the compatibility suite, and avoids direct session access. No schema changes this cycle. Report breakage on the tracker with your adapter name. Pin your tests to the compatibility build identified by the token below.

session token of tajef-bageg = htk21_5d90d574934f3ccae6437

The Marlowe fleet sits behind the Bryttle balancer, which probes each node's health endpoint. Probe volume scales with node count, so plan headroom: at 200 nodes the checks alone consume one vCPU per zone. Keep intervals and failure thresholds consistent across pools. Current probe tuning constants are as follows.

tuning table, kajog-bawip:
TIERS = {
    "kelius": 256,
    "lammir": 543,
}

// REINDEX_BATCH_CAP limits docs per shard pass in the Tallowfield
// nightly search reindex. Raising it starves the ingest queue;
// lowering it overruns the maintenance window. 5000 is the tested
// sweet spot. Change only with a soak run. Verified against the
// build noted below.

session token of bawif-hahog = htk6_ac5981

## ProfileVault Environments

ProfileVault shards the user-profile store across four partitions in staging and sixteen in production. Shard assignment is hash-based on account ID, so rebalancing only happens during planned resharding windows. If you're on call and see hot-shard alerts, check the partition map before touching anything — most pages resolve to a single overloaded shard. The active shard configuration for production is as follows.

settings of hahag-taweg:
[jorius]
team = gilox
access_code = ac_b64218
host = jorius.zarqelstack.example
port = 8080
owner = quenath.briax
peer = eliix.halixcloud.corp